Students Attempt Charles River Swim; Large-Scale Emergency Response Ensues

Cambridge, MA – October 26, 2023 – A reckless late-night swim attempt in the Charles River by a group of college students triggered a significant emergency response early this morning, highlighting the inherent dangers of unsupervised swimming in urban waterways. The incident, which involved multiple agencies and resulted in several hospitalizations, underscores the critical need for increased public awareness regarding water safety.

The incident unfolded around 2:00 AM near the Massachusetts Avenue Bridge. According to Cambridge Police Department spokesperson, Officer David Miller, several 911 calls reported a group of individuals struggling in the notoriously cold and unpredictable waters of the Charles River. "The water temperature this time of year is dangerously low," Officer Miller stated. "Hypothermia sets in rapidly, and the strong currents can easily overwhelm even strong swimmers."

<h3>A Multi-Agency Rescue Operation</h3>

The response was swift and extensive. Cambridge Fire Department, Boston Fire Department, and the Massachusetts State Police Marine Unit all participated in the rescue operation. Divers entered the water, while rescue boats navigated the challenging currents. Emergency medical services were on standby to treat those pulled from the river.

"The situation was quite chaotic initially," explained a firefighter who wished to remain anonymous. "We had multiple individuals in distress, and the darkness and the cold added to the complexity of the rescue."

At least five students were pulled from the water suffering from hypothermia and exhaustion. While all are expected to survive, several were transported to area hospitals for treatment. The exact number of students involved remains unclear, with authorities investigating the incident further.

<h3>The Dangers of Unsupervised Swimming in the Charles River</h3>

The Charles River, while a picturesque landmark, poses significant risks to swimmers. The unpredictable currents, combined with submerged debris and the consistently cold water temperatures, make it a dangerous environment, particularly without proper supervision and safety precautions. This incident serves as a stark reminder of these dangers. Numerous accidents have occurred in the past, emphasizing the need for caution and responsible behavior around the river.

  • Cold Water Shock: Sudden immersion in cold water can lead to rapid breathing difficulties and loss of coordination, increasing the risk of drowning.
  • Strong Currents: The Charles River's currents are significantly stronger than many people realize, easily overpowering even experienced swimmers.
  • Hidden Hazards: Submerged objects, debris, and uneven riverbeds present significant risks to swimmers.
